                                                                Synonyms: receptor activator of nuclear factor κB ligand | osteoclast differentiation factor (ODF) | osteoprotegerin ligand | TNFSF11
                                 Compound class: 
                                                            Endogenous peptide in human, mouse or rat
                                 
                                    
                                        Comment: RANK ligand (TNFSF11) is a member of the tumor necrosis factor (TNF) cytokine family. It can exist in both membrane-bound and soluble forms. It is a key factor for osteoclast differentiation and activation. Osteoprotegerin acts as a decoy receptor for RANK ligand.
